Transaction 2afa495bd0c6763f9cd15ce319ba01c3918e54ea917a82c50d053a841fc9359d

2 Input
1 Outputs
  • 2afa495bd0c6763f9cd15ce319ba01c3918e54ea917a82c50d053a841fc9359d:0
  • value  2868590
    address  32vSiqM2u7u1wxpmu7nH35BHjZDVYWDPw6